NICE Once Again Leads the WFM Market According to Analyst Firm DMG Consulting


RA'ANANA, Israel, April 6, 2015 /PRNewswire/ --

NICE Systems (NASDAQ: NICE) today announced that for the eighth consecutive year, it has been recognized as the contact center workforce management (WFM) market leader by DMG Consulting LLC.

In DMG's 2015 Contact Center Workforce Management Report, NICE is recognized as having the largest market share based on number of seats, with a 23.7 percent share. NICE achieved an impressive 14.8 percent increase in number of seats in 2014. In addition, NICE received the top ranking for Product Satisfaction, based on vendor average, with a score of 4.33 out of 5. This ranking is significant as the results were derived directly from DMG facilitated customer surveys.

"WFM empowers employees by enabling them to actively participate in the scheduling process, which positions them to self-manage their work/life balance. It also engages employees by giving them performance data to motivate the 'right' behaviors and results," said Donna Fluss, president of DMG Consulting. "WFM is in the process of transforming into an engagement tool that can help drive high levels of agent productivity, satisfaction, and retention, while improving quality and reducing the cost of service."

NICE's Workforce Management solution puts the power of optimization i clients' hands, enabling them to enhance their contact center performance and back office operations for measurable business value and an exceptional customer experience. NICE's solution provides the tools to address the complex scheduling and forecasting needs of large multi-site, multi-skill, and multi-channel contact center and back office operations. Solutions are available as hosted, onsite, or SaaS, so customers can choose whichever model makes the most sense for their business.
